Well, I’m not sure who told you this, but flavors can be very non-kosher. I’ve been in plenty of flavor production plants. Basar v’chalav, tallow, treif fatty acids, treif fatty alcohols and aldehydes, oils, emulsifiers, catalysts, etc etc.
Citric acid is less of an issue but occasionally it is a problem. (Plus for Pesach issues of Chometz and Kitniyos).
